/ 根目录
    分区大小一定要充足,一般不小于5GB
/bin,/usr/bin 普通用户使用命令
    建议和/放一起
/sbin,/usr/sbin 管理员使用命令
/bin,/sbin 操作系统自身启动运行就需要用到的程序
/usr/bin,/usr/sbin 基本的系统工具
/usr/local/bin,/usr/local/sbin 第三方程序命令
以上均为二进制程序
/,/usr,/usr/local均可以独立分区
共享库:公共的功能模块
/lib 为/bin和/sbin提供服务,一般来说/bin,/sbin,/usr/bin,/usr/sbin的库都在/lib
    和/放一起
/usr/lib 用的较少
/usr/local/lib 为/usr/local/bin,/usr/local/sbin提供服务
/etc 一般来说,命令的配置文件都在/etc下
    不能单独分区
/tmp 存放临时文件
/var/log 存放日志
    /var/mail 邮件
    /var/cache 缓存
    建议单独分区
/proc 伪文件系统 内核的各种特性、参数的输出目录,表现为一个个的文件 内核映像
    不需单独分区
/sys 伪文件系统 硬件信息 硬盘、
/media 专门用来挂载 u盘、
    和/放一起
/mnt 关联分区,约定熟成
    和/放一起
/opt 可选目录
/misc 自动挂载服务需要的目录
    建议和/放一起
/boot 引导目录 放内核
    建议单独分成第一主分区,以方便排除系统启动故障,大小为100MB左右
/home 家目录
    建议单独分区
/root 管理员目录
    一般和/放一起
/dev 设备文件 所有硬件设备
    建议和/放一起
    设备类型:
        b 块设备 随机设备 支持随机访问
        c 线性设备
    硬盘设备:既支持线性访问,也支持随机访问,通常称为随机存取设备
        I/O,I/O controller
             I/O Adapter
        IDE,ATA 并行,133MB/s
        SCSI 小型计算机系统接口(Small Computer System Interface) UltraSCSI--320MB/s
        SATA Serail,300MB/s,600MB/s,6Gb/s
        SAS 6Gb/s
        USB
/lost+found 每个分区都有,存放孤儿文件
/selinux 增强性安全linux
    和/放一起
/swap 交换分区
    建议单独分区,一般大小为物理内存的两倍左右
    
linux系统安装分区建议:
    /boot,第一主分区,100MB
    /,根分区,5GB

linux根下目录详解及分区建议的更多相关文章

  1. Linux中重要目录详解

    Linux重要目录详解 / 根目录,第一层目录,所有其他目录的根,一般根目录下只存放目录.包括:/bin, /boot, /dev, /etc, /home, /lib, /mnt, /opt, /p ...

  2. MySQL在Linux系统下配置文件详解

    在日常的的开发过程中接触到了SQLServer和MySQL数据库的操作性问题,可能是以前接触的都是SQL Server,才开始接触MySQL,总感觉使用MySQL没有使用SQLserver那么顺手,一 ...

  3. Linux中etc目录详解大全总汇详解

    /etc etc不是什么缩写,是and so on的意思 来源于 法语的 et cetera 翻译成中文就是 等等 的意思. 至于为什么在/etc下面存放配置文件, 按照原始的UNIX的说法(Linu ...

  4. linux 软件安装目录详解

    我一般会在/opt目录下创建 一个software目录,用来存放我们从官网下载的软件格式是.tar.gz文件,或者通过 wget+地址下载的.tar.gz文件 执行解压缩命令,这里以nginx举例 t ...

  5. Android jniLibs下目录详解(.so文件)

    http://www.jianshu.com/p/b758e36ae9b5 最近又研究了一下,参考了一下:三星/联发科等处理器规格表 更新时间:2017年5月手机CPU架构体系分类及各大厂商 PS:我 ...

  6. golang 在 Mac , Linux , Windows 下交叉编译详解

    一. 前言 Golang 支持交叉编译, 在一个平台上生成然后再另外一个平台去执行. 而且编译的工具[build]这个工具是Golang 内置的,不需要你去下载第三方的包啥的,贼方便. 二. 交叉编译 ...

  7. Linux中/proc目录下文件详解

    转载于:http://blog.chinaunix.net/uid-10449864-id-2956854.html Linux中/proc目录下文件详解(一)/proc文件系统下的多种文件提供的系统 ...

  8. Linux中/proc目录下文件详解(转贴)

      转载:http://www.sudu.cn/info/index.php?op=article&id=302529   Linux中/proc目录下文件详解(一) 声明:可以自由转载本文, ...

  9. linux基础之LSB定义的常用目录详解

    Linux基础之LSB定义的基本目录详解 1.LSB中FHS(Filesystem Hierarchy Standard)定义的一些文件 /boot:主要是存放引导文件的目录,比如内核文件(vmlin ...

随机推荐

  1. HTML5的Server-Sent Events功能的使用

    客户端代码示例 //创建一个新的 EventSource 对象,然后规定发送更新的页面的 URL. var source = new EventSource("http://localhos ...

  2. [cocos2d]场景切换以及切换进度显示

    本文主要分两个部分叙述,第一是场景切换,第二是场景切换的进度显示. 一.场景切换 参考learn-iphone-and-ipad-cocos2d-game-development 第五章内容 coco ...

  3. git stash的使用

    https://git-scm.com/docs/git-stash 在git svn的时候使用,提交记录的时候,有部分文件的修改不需要commit. 在向svn进行git svn dcommit的时 ...

  4. poj1741 bzoj2152

    树分治入门 poj1741是男人八题之一,经典的树分治的题目这里用到的是点分治核心思想是我们把某个点i作为根,把路径分为过点i和不过点i先统计过点i这样的路径数,然后在统计其子树中的答案,这样就不断地 ...

  5. 解决ASP.NET MVC AllowAnonymous属性无效导致无法匿名访问控制器的问题

    在ASP.NET MVC项目中,一般都要使用身份验证和权限控制,但总有部分网页是可以匿名访问的.使用AllowAnonymous属性就可以指定需要匿名访问的控制器,从而跳过身份验证. 但是今天却遇到一 ...

  6. Chrome 浏览器地址栏直接搜索太慢的解决方案

    用Chrome经常直接把要搜索的内容写在地址栏, 回国就搜索,但最近发现搜索结果出来得太慢,要刷新好几次才行. 解决方案如下: 打开Chrome的"设置", 找到”管理搜索引擎“, ...

  7. Never use GetDate() when comparing date timesoffsets, use SYSDATETIMEOFFSET()

    -- my current uk time is 2014-01-09 10:43:00 +0 ) = '2014-01-09 18:43:00 +08:00'; ) = '2014-01-09 02 ...

  8. strncpy 用法

    strncpy   用法 原型:extern char *strncpy(char *dest, char *src, int n); 用法:#include <string.h> 功能: ...

  9. HTTP 错误 404.3 - Forbidden

    在iis中能够浏览所有扩展名的文件时,IIS MIME的 映射 您只能在故障排除过程中将通配符映射添加到 IIS MIME 映射中,以作为一种临时解决方案.确定缺少 MIME 类型是问题的原因后,请删 ...

  10. JSP控制select不可再选择

    首先分析下disable ,display和readonly: 1,Readonly只针对input(text / password)和textarea有效,而disabled对于所有的表单元素都有效 ...